07
Strica

Folosind instrumente de terţă parte în SharePoint

    SharePoint Tools

    Creşterea economică în instrumente de terţă parte

    Am lucrat cu SharePoint ca un cadru, deoarece întregul său de presă al scară prima dată în 2001. De atunci am asistat la o creştere constantă în instrumente de terţă parte să fie îmbunătăţiri pentru a oferi functionalitate mai slabe furnizate "out of the box" (OOTB) de către SharePoint sau caracteristici noi pentru a completa funcţionalitatea de bază existente.

    Cele mai multe părţi utilitati terţe sau părţi de web au început să iasă cu lansarea anterioare de SharePoint (SharePoint 2003 & WSS V2). Dar cu lansarea Microsoft Office SharePoint Server (MOSS) 2007 (şi WSS V3), a existat o creştere exponenţială într-o varietate întreagă de utilizator final sau concentrat instrumente administrative.

    întreprinderi întregi au apărut, de fapt, peste câteva ultimii ani cu talpa modelul lor de afaceri care vizează satisfacerea cererii clare pentru agregatorii de listă, de backup si migrare utilitati sau de raportare accesorii, pentru a numi doar câteva. Nu uita de MVP, Open Source eforturile la peste Codeplex şi locul de muncă prin anumite persoane, adesea denumită în posturi şi bloguri în cadrul comunităţii SharePoint.

    dureri de creştere

    De creştere în instrumente terţ şi completarea SharePoint comunitate, care oferă, de asemenea, o vastă gamă de multe ori "liber" de utilităţi downladabil, înseamnă întreprinderile implementarea SharePoint nu au fost niciodată mai bine servite şi pot câştiga fără îndoială, mai mult chiar a investiţiilor prin utilizarea lor în cele mai recente Microsoft SharePoint tehnologie.

    Cu toate acestea, experienţa mea de peste câteva ultimii ani cu utilitati terţ, în special cu natura însăşi şi, adesea, imature utilitare noi si add-onuri, a condus-mi să cred că aceste instrumente pot fi plină de probleme pentru neglijent.

      Probleme întâlnite includ:

    • Codul dezvoltate şi testate într-un mediu Moss, nu în mod special WSS (dar eliberat pentru ambele tipuri de platforme, oricum, cauzând funcţii cheie pretinse a fi disponibile, care nu reuşesc să lucreze ca acestea nu sunt susţinute sau disponibile în WSS)

    • Instrumente şi utilitare de multe ori neacceptate şi oferite pentru download pe o "ca este" baza

    • Slaba documentare, pentru a permite eficiente şi sigure de configurare şi setarea

    • Mică sau nici o testare înainte de eliberarea, prin urmare, instrumentele sunt "buggy" şi instabil

    • Nedovedite uzabilitate şi funcţionalitate în întreaga echilibrat medii de sarcină

    • Slaba sau inexistente utilizator final suport non.

    Chiar şi unele dintre instrumentele de mai bine treia parte cunoscut de pe piaţă au, în experienţa mea, a fost destul de slab dezvoltate, prin urmare, companiile de dezvoltare nu sunt în măsură să răspundă chiar şi de asistenţă conexe interogări de bază sau bug-uri de produs. Instrumente şi utilitare de multe ori au fost în mod clar dezvoltat pe şi pentru medii de muschi, dar publicitate pentru WSS, de asemenea, cu dezvoltatorii originare ştiind foarte bine acolo vor fi probleme cu mic set de caracteristici sale. Cred că acestea sunt în creştere dureri doar întreprinderilor mici şi sperăm că dezvoltarea proceselor şi serviciile lor de suport se vor îmbunătăţi în timp.

    Este produsul dvs. selectat terţ într-adevăr o alegere bună?

    Este clar multe dintre instrumentele disponibile sunt extrem de utile, altfel nu ar fi fost create pentru a umple un gol în primul rând, sau vândute atât de bine. Eu cred totuşi că întreprinderile, persoane fără experienţă sau, mai degrabă, de multe ori uita (sau pur şi simplu nu ştiu) să ia în considerare pe deplin problemele implicate în implementarea produselor treilea partid care au fost dezvoltate in afara de certificate Microsoft şi medii de bază altă platformă.

    Care a fost o dată dumneavoastră relativ curată, stabil şi mediul de bază a fost acum "de DLL-uri", de web. Config modificări murdărit şi setările de registry. Acest lucru vă oferă, cu riscul unui nivel potenţial de instabilitate, care este inacceptabil, care rezultă în nenumarate ore încercarea de a depana şi a rezolva probleme care ar fi putut fi evitată, în primul rând. Prin urmare, se angajeze în implementarea acestor instrumente fără de due diligence buna la pericol!

    Întrebări cu privire la instrumente de terţă parte, aş sugera să ia în considerare sunt după cum urmează:

    • De sprijin - Are organizaţia furniza actualizări în timp util şi bug fixat la componentele? Va fi susţinută în platforma de 64 bit? Are nevoie de ea şi să lucreze efectiv în browsere diferite? Ce spun altii despre produs în cadrul Comunităţii? Cine va plăti pentru ao sprijini pe plan intern? Ce se întâmplă dacă persoana pe care-l lasă instalat?

  • actualizări Cod - Ai nevoie şi au, prin urmare, accesul la sursa de control pentru dezvoltatori pentru a face modificări şi sprijin in-house? Ce este foaia de parcurs pentru actualizările de produs următoarele actualizări pachet de servicii emise de la Microsoft? Vor fi afectate de produs actualizări service pack de la Microsoft?

  • Robusteţe / Stabilitate - Ce tip de testare a fost efectuată înainte de eliberarea? Codul a fost dezvoltat pe ambele Moss şi platforme WSS? A produs a fost testat pe echilibrate fermele de sarcină? Funcţionează în fermele cu mai mulţi? Există probleme de performanţă pe liste sau indexare? Are un impact asupra OOTB caracteristici existente sau a altor instrumente de terţă parte dislocate? Va afecta paginile existente şi a datelor? Cum este instalat, WSP, STP şi / sau DLL-uri?

  • Scalabilitatea / securitate - Ce nivelul şi tipul de acces de securitate are nevoie de la ferma ta? Pe scară largă ca va creste de la desfăşurarea unică pentru mai multe servere?

  • Costul - Care sunt costurile totale pentru implementarea instrumente de terţă parte pe dvs. live, de pre-producţie şi medii de dezvoltare? Care este adevăratul cost anual de sprijin?

  • În cele din urmă, apoi, organizaţiile pot câştiga şi de a face o mare cantitate de valoare pentru bani de la investitiile lor, atâta timp cât acestea investească în mod inteligent. Cu toate acestea, cred că o cantitate considerabilă de afaceri va avea numeroase probleme de-a face cu performanţă, funcţionalitate, fiabilitate sau stabilitatea atunci când se utilizează instrumente de terţă parte.

    De due diligence

    Pentru a reduce expunerea la astfel de probleme atunci când achiziţionează instrumente de terţă parte SharePoint si utilitati, ar trebui să efectueze o revizuire adecvată şi procesul de justificare, cu aceste produse.

    Vă recomandăm următoarele ca un ghid:

    • Înţelegerea în detaliu ceea ce le va lua pentru a oferi o evaluare si testare a instrument de terţă parte (e) presupunând că veţi crea un mediu separat pentru a face acest lucru

    • Document o listă de afaceri şi / sau cerinţele tehnice pe care trebuie să îndeplinească, însoţită de o listă de caracteristici de produs a declarat. Compara & evalua

    • dacă este posibil "de pre-producţie" evaluare medii de revizuire în cât mai aproape de o "pentru ca" scenariu similar, iti poti permite (UAT de preferat)

    • Citiţi SharePoint forumuri de specialitate şi feedback-ul necesar de la alţii care au folosit un anumit produs înainte de implementarea şi gabaritul, în esenţă, o viziune asupra altora experienţa de utilizare a produsului

    • Asiguraţi-vă că au un backup / restore abordare care funcţionează (şi de fapt a fost testat), în cazul în care aveţi nevoie pentru a rollback în urma unui instrument / implementare produs din cauza unor probleme sau a altor constrângeri

    • Asiguraţi-vă că au luat în considerare pre-productie si de recuperare în caz de catastrofe în dumneavoastră de planificare, de testare şi a bugetelor

    • Luaţi în considerare documentaţia necesară pentru a instala nu numai, ci pentru a oferi sprijin pentru echipa helpdesk-ul dvs responsabili pentru sprijinul şi generale de guvernare

    • Înainte de a demara procesul de introducere a 3a parte instrumente face cu adevarat uita-te la setul de caracteristici furnizate afară de la cutie şi să înţeleagă dacă modificările minore ale cerinţelor existente, se pot face pentru a evita introducerea unor astfel de produse sau bespoke modificări

    • În cazul în care un instrument de terţă parte să fie puse la dispoziţia utilizatorilor finali, să se asigure de afaceri de testare adecvate şi de formare este planificată şi puse la dispoziţie în avans cu privire la orice proces de implementare sau pilot.


    Concluzie

    Simplul motiv pentru acest post este de a te face conştienţi de pericolele de a introduce instrumente de terţă parte în SharePoint medii dumneavoastră şi să recomande o serie de măsuri pentru a lua pentru a vă ajuta să înţelegeţi şi să decidă dacă un instrument de terţă parte este potrivita pentru tine. În al treilea rând instrumente şi de a face parte poate adauga o valoare reala, dar asiguraţi-vă că aceste instrumente nu întrerupă dumneavoastră de bază mediu SharePoint.

    În rezumat, trebuie să vă asiguraţi că aveţi unele asigurări că de fapt desfăşurarea oricărei componente terţ este cu adevărat de gând să economisiţi bani, sau furnizează anumite demn şi alte beneficii tangibile.

    Măsurile trebuie să fie, de asemenea, luate de către dumneavoastră pentru a se asigura că instrumentele necertificate nu se vor deteriora existente SharePoint mediul de bază şi că acestea sunt uşor de gestionat şi acceptabilă în ceea ce priveşte costurile de sprijin pe termen lung.

    În cele din urmă, aşa cum am postat in Revista SharePoint recent, aveţi potenţial "remuneraţie" pentru bespoke modificările şi îndoielnică, instrumente treilea partid, o oarecare măsură, de mai multe ori peste. Prin urmare, ţi faci temele înainte de a descărca acea parte de web de evaluare şi setup.exe presa!

    Ceea ce priveşte,

    Andrew

    Echipa WorkShares

    Notă:

    Arno Nel care conduce revista SharePoint , publicat acest articol excelent pe revista online său despre " Folosind instrumente de terţă parte în SharePoint ".

    Lectură plăcută şi sper vi se pare util.

    • Share / Bookmark

    2 Răspunsuri la "Utilizarea treilea petrecere unealtă în SharePoint"

    1. migra sau a muta conţinut în interiorul SharePoint | WorkShares Blog spune:

      [...] Sau unele alt drum liber pe internet! Şi înainte de a merge mai departe şi a instala un produs 3rd party, citiţi acest articol am scris o perioada de timp [...]

    2. Cawood spune:

      Ma bucur ca sunteti cuvântul. Oricine caută pentru software-ul SharePoint ar trebui să facă o coace-off cu opţiuni diferite şi să fie siguri că au cel potrivit pentru nevoile lor.

      De asemenea, aveţi grijă să întreb dacă software-ul va face lucruri care încalcă acordul de asistenţă Microsoft. De exemplu, scris direct la DB SharePoint.

    Plecare un Reply